How can I develop a consistent reading habit, especially when I have a busy schedule?

Developing a consistent reading habit with a busy schedule requires strategy and intentionality. The key is to integrate reading into your existing routine rather than trying to find large, uninterrupted blocks of time, which are often scarce. Start by setting very small, achievable goals, such as reading for just 10-15 minutes each day. This could be during your commute, on a lunch break, or right before bed. Always keep a book or e-reader with you so you can seize those unexpected pockets of free time. Consider audiobooks as well; they are excellent for multitasking, allowing you to 'read' while driving, exercising, or doing chores. Try to create a dedicated reading space in your home that is comfortable and free from distractions, making it more appealing to sit down and read. Also, don't be afraid to switch books if one isn't capturing your interest; life is too short to force yourself through a book you're not enjoying. Experiment with different genres and formats to find what truly engages you. Finally, track your progress, even if it's just a simple tally of pages or minutes read. Seeing your progress can be a great motivator.
